Transaction 21df3010aa6dd3a7bf65c805da471a4ded72fc1ed10b4ed5d4ea0afb5a164923

1 Input
2 Outputs
  • 21df3010aa6dd3a7bf65c805da471a4ded72fc1ed10b4ed5d4ea0afb5a164923:0
  • value  100000
    address  13987dLTeYymyj8fbXA3S8HeMK94iPemCr
  • 21df3010aa6dd3a7bf65c805da471a4ded72fc1ed10b4ed5d4ea0afb5a164923:1
  • value  877235
    address  bc1qxf6h9fqr225e3tlmqehxtpf04ys9c0z0m4wz32